Living in Charlottesville, VA

Charlottesville, VA, is a historic city with a rich cultural scene, a variety of local dining options, lush parks, and outdoor activities. It offers a small-town feel with access to modern amenities, making it an attractive place for families and young professionals. The presence of the University of Virginia adds to the city's vibrant atmosphere and educational opportunities.

Home Value Estimator For Charlottesville, VA

There are currently 38,972 real estate properties in Charlottesville, VA, with a median automated valuation model (AVM) price of $501,094.00. What is an AVM? It is a smart computer program that analyzes and predicts the approximate value of a home, property or land in Charlottesville, VA, based on current market trends, comparable real estate sales nearby, historical data and, of course, property features, among other variables. These automated home estimates are often very helpful, providing buyers and sellers with a better idea of a home’s value ahead of the negotiation process.
